Services for Business Moves
Office Relocations (Small to Large Corporate Spaces)
Every office has unique needs. A medical office requires extra care for specialized equipment. Law firms need secure handling of confidential files. Large corporate headquarters involve phased moves to keep departments operational. We adapt our process to match your business environment.
Packing & Labeling Systems
Organization is key. We use department-based labels, color-coded systems, and detailed inventories so everything arrives at your new location ready to go. Accounting files stay with accounting, IT systems with IT, and marketing materials with marketing. No more lost files or mixed-up departments.
Furniture Assembly & Reconfiguration
Office furniture is complex. Cubicles, conference tables, and executive desks require careful disassembly, transport, and reassembly. We photograph and label everything, bag hardware, and ensure your furniture is reconfigured to fit your new layout.
IT Equipment & Electronics Handling
Computers, servers, and telecom systems cannot be packed like household items. We use anti-static materials, padded cases, and climate-controlled transport. Our crews coordinate with your IT team to shut down and restart systems properly, preventing costly data loss or downtime.
Secure Storage Solutions
When move-out and move-in dates do not align, we offer climate-controlled storage. Business records, electronics, and furniture stay safe under monitored security systems. Access is flexible, so you can retrieve equipment as needed during the transition.

FAQs
How much downtime should a company expect during a move?
Most office moves take 1–3 days. Small offices are often operational within 24 hours, while large corporate relocations may require several days of phased moving.
Can movers handle sensitive electronics and servers?
Yes. We use anti-static materials, climate-controlled trucks, and coordinate with your IT team to ensure proper shutdown and startup of equipment.
What insurance options are available for commercial moves?
Basic liability covers only 60 cents per pound, which is rarely enough for business equipment. We provide valuation protection that covers replacement costs for office technology, furniture, and files.
Do movers work outside normal business hours?
Yes. Evening and weekend moves are common. This flexibility reduces disruption to your operations and often saves money compared to weekday downtime.
